Zaraz Goggle Ads Config

Ads not working in Google Ads

Want to track on click events. If click URL Contains: mailto see original gtag in screenshot

1.) configured Google Ads (zaraz third party tools)
2.) Created a Trigger Gads Click - Just Links": Match rule, URL, Contains, mailto
3.) Created ab Action “GAds - Mail Clicks”, Firing Trigger “Gads Click - Just Links”, insert: Conversion Label: alAKCxxxxxxxxxxxxx

You will find original gtag manager scheme attached

To track a local event on the client that doesn’t post back to your server (and thus isn’t sent to cloudflare along the way), like clicking a mailto: link, you’ll need to add a javascript listener for the local event.

You can do that with custom code, or with one of the listeners built-in. For example, for most clicks you can use their default click listener: Triggers and rules · Cloudflare Zaraz docs (they also have scroll-depth and a few others, similar ot the defaults in GTM).

Since you probably don’t have every mailto link coded with a CSS tag, you can use an Xpath expression to detect mailto: links specifically. I believe this will work (not tested):
//a[starts-with(., 'mailto:')]/@href
You can then use a Match Rule to filter which pages that fires upon if you wish, but that just filters the events similar to adding additional rules to your example from GTM.